Hi,

I am from Argentina and got married there with my Spanish wife. Living here in UK for 6yrs and got my ILR (EEA settled status) already. Turns out we gonna get divorced. Do I need to inform HO about it? I do need to reapply for the ILR?

Thanks in advance

Absolutely not. Your divorce has no effect on your ILR at all. You are settled in the UK as per UK immigration rules and granted ILR. That is the end of the road for any immigration dependence on your spouse. ILR when granted never lapses (unless you leave the UK for more than 2 years) and your relationship with your spouse has no effect on it anymore
